DynamicMethod.IsDefined(Type, Boolean) Méthode

Définition

Indique si le type d’attribut personnalisé spécifié est défini.

public:
 override bool IsDefined(Type ^ attributeType, bool inherit);
public override bool IsDefined (Type attributeType, bool inherit);
override this.IsDefined : Type * bool -> bool
Public Overrides Function IsDefined (attributeType As Type, inherit As Boolean) As Boolean

Paramètres

attributeType
Type

Type qui représente le type d’attribut personnalisé à rechercher.

inherit
Boolean

true pour explorer la chaîne d’héritage de la méthode et rechercher les attributs personnalisés ; false pour vérifier uniquement la méthode actuelle.

Retours

true si le type d’attribut personnalisé spécifié est défini ; sinon, false.

Remarques

Pour les méthodes dynamiques, spécifier true pour inherit n’a aucun effet. Les méthodes dynamiques n’ont aucune chaîne d’héritage.

Notes

Les attributs personnalisés ne sont actuellement pas pris en charge sur les méthodes dynamiques.

S’applique à

Voir aussi